Clinical Implication of Atrial Fibrillation Detection Using Wearable Device in Patients With Cryptogenic Stroke

It is known that atrial fibrillation after stroke significantly increases the risk of stroke or systemic embolism. Accordingly, efforts have been made to detect hidden atrial fibrillation and apply treatment using anticoagulants instead of antiplatelet agents. The conventional method used to screen for atrial fibrillation in stroke patients who did not have atrial fibrillation at first admission is 24-hour Holter monitoring. This study will compare the detection rate of atrial fibrillation with discontinuous ECG monitoring three times a day and 72 hours of single-lead ECG patch monitoring compared with the conventional Holter test.

Inclusion criteria

  • Newly diagnosed brain infarction
  • No history and diagnosis of atrial fibrillation at the time of admission
  • Rejected implantable loop recorder
  • Informed consent

Exclusion criteria

  • Cannot use KardiaMobile system alone or with the help of others

Treatment and study plan

Discontinuous monitoring

Device

Discontinuous ECG monitoring by finger contact every day

Continuous single-lead ECG Patch

Device

Continuous 72hr ECG monitoring by a single-lead patch at 3, 6, 9, 12 months after stroke

24-hour Holter monitoring

Device

Continuous 24-hour monitoring by Holter monitor at 1, 6, 12 month after stroke

Primary outcomes

  1. Atrial fibrillation detection rate

    Time frame: Until 1 year after stroke

    Compare detection rates of each arms

Secondary outcomes

  1. Change from antiplatelet therapy to anticoagulants following AF detection

    Time frame: Until 1 year after stroke

    Change from antiplatelet therapy to anticoagulants following AF detection

  2. Major adverse cardiac and cerebrovascular event

    Time frame: Until 1 year after stroke

    composite of nonfatal stroke, nonfatal myocardial infarction, and cardiovascular death

  3. Re-admission

    Time frame: Until 1 year after stroke

    Re-admission

  4. All-cause death

    Time frame: Until 1 year after stroke

    All-cause death

Other outcomes

  1. Major bleeding

    Time frame: Until 1 year after stroke

    Fatal or overt bleeding with a drop in hemoglobin level of at least 2 g/dL or requiring transfusion of at least 2 units packed blood cells, or critical anatomical site hemorrhage (e.g., intracranial, retroperitoneal)
